FYI - The maximum power I've run with my 43-foot vertical and matching
system is 1200 watts with no problems experienced for several months. But
then one humid morning the unit did arc from the output connection across
the electrical box to a nearby ground point (you could see a nice carbon
trace across the box). The SWR jumped suddenly and the amplifier (ALS-1300)
tripped out like it should. I replaced the output screw with a ceramic
feedthru and haven't had the problem since. As Tom W8JI stated, the
voltages can be extremely high especially if you are running high power. If
you run an amplifier, I'd recommend using a ceramic feedthru output, and
keep the output port several inches away from any ground connections.
